Choosing the Right Neutral Palette

Choosing the Right Neutral Palette for Style Your Bedroom in Neutral Tones With Mid-Century Modern Flair

When I think about creating a serene bedroom atmosphere, choosing the right neutral palette is essential. I love how soft beiges, gentle grays, and warm whites can instantly calm the space. By selecting these hues, I can create a backdrop that feels both inviting and invigorating.

I often start with a light base, like cream or soft taupe, which opens up the room and makes it feel airy. Then, I layer in deeper shades, like a rich charcoal or muted sage, to add depth and interest.

Textures also play a crucial role; mixing fabrics like linen, cotton, and wool brings warmth and comfort. Ultimately, the right neutral palette sets the perfect tone for relaxation and rejuvenation in my bedroom.

Selecting Mid-Century Modern Furniture

Selecting Mid-Century Modern Furniture for Style Your Bedroom in Neutral Tones With Mid-Century Modern Flair

While I appreciate the clean lines and functional elegance of mid-century modern furniture, selecting the right pieces for my bedroom can truly elevate the space.

Here’s what I consider when choosing:

  1. Simplicity: I look for furniture with minimal ornamentation, allowing the beauty of the materials to shine.
  2. Natural Materials: Wood, leather, and fabric are my go-tos, as they add warmth and texture to the room.
  3. Functional Design: I opt for pieces that serve a purpose, like a nightstand with built-in storage.
  4. Timeless Shapes: I favor iconic silhouettes, such as a low-profile bed or a sleek dresser, to create that quintessential mid-century vibe.

With these guidelines, I can curate a bedroom that feels both stylish and inviting.

Incorporating Statement Lighting

Incorporating Statement Lighting for Style Your Bedroom in Neutral Tones With Mid-Century Modern Flair

Layering textures adds a rich foundation to any bedroom, but the right lighting can elevate that ambiance to new heights.

I’ve found that statement lighting not only serves a practical purpose but also acts as a focal point.

Here are some ideas to inspire you:

  1. Oversized Pendants: A large pendant light can create a stunning centerpiece above your bed or seating area.
  2. Sculptural Floor Lamps: Choose a floor lamp with an artistic design to add personality while providing warmth.
  3. Wall Sconces: Mounted sconces beside your bed offer both style and functional lighting for reading.
  4. Table Lamps with Flair: Unique table lamps can enhance your nightstands, adding character without overwhelming the space.

With the right choices, your bedroom will shine in both style and comfort.

Accessorizing With Plants

Accessorizing With Plants for Style Your Bedroom in Neutral Tones With Mid-Century Modern Flair

There’s something magical about bringing plants into a bedroom, as they effortlessly breathe life into the space.

I love incorporating a variety of greenery to create a serene atmosphere. Start with low-maintenance options like snake plants or pothos; they thrive in low light and add a touch of elegance.

Place a tall plant in the corner to draw the eye upward, making the room feel more spacious. For surfaces, consider small succulents or a delicate peace lilyβ€”they’re perfect for adding texture without overwhelming the decor.

Don’t forget hanging plants! They can soften the room’s edges and introduce a sense of whimsy.

Ultimately, plants not only enhance your bedroom’s aesthetic but also improve air quality, creating a rejuvenating retreat.

Creating a Functional Layout

Creating a Functional Layout for Style Your Bedroom in Neutral Tones With Mid-Century Modern Flair

When designing a functional layout for your bedroom, it’s essential to contemplate both flow and personal habits. I always start by considering how I move through the space and what I need at arm’s reach.

Here are four key points to guarantee your layout works for you:

Consider these four essential points to ensure your bedroom layout is both functional and tailored to your needs.

  1. Bed Placement: Position your bed against a wall that allows easy access and maximizes natural light.
  2. Nightstands: Place nightstands on either side of the bed for balance and convenience.
  3. Storage Solutions: Utilize under-bed storage or multi-functional furniture to keep clutter at bay.
  4. Walking Paths: Ensure there’s ample space for walking between furniture pieces, creating an inviting and open atmosphere.

With these tips, you’ll create a bedroom that’s both stylish and practical.

? How can I incorporate mid-century modern elements into my bedroom?
Incorporating mid-century modern flair is all about bold shapes and natural materials! Look for furniture with clean lines, like a low-profile bed or a sleek dresser. Add in some iconic pieces, like a starburst mirror or a tripod floor lamp, to really capture that retro vibe. Don’t forget about the woodβ€”teak or walnut accents can really bring warmth to your neutral palette!
